Norway's first adventure games
This is a digital preservation recovery that corrects the historical record—previously available details about these games were vague and largely wrong. For engineers interested in computing history or software archaeology, it demonstrates that significant code from the minicomputer era can still be located and restored decades later.

SVHA Adventure is an expanded version of the original Colossal Cave Adventure, developed for Norsk Data minicomputers at NTH in Trondheim in 1979.
Ringen is an original text adventure set in the Mines of Moria from Lord of the Rings, developed at UiT in Tromsø a couple of years later.
Working copies of both games are now available online, despite neither having been accessible on the internet before this recovery effort.
